Ravi Chana told us:
My Family of two adults & two Children (aged 15 and 10) thoroughly enjoyed our safari experience booked via Bobby Tours and Safaris in August 2010. The company were most helpful with making arrangements to suit our needs and to accomodate what we wanted within the short space of time we had. They were able to advise and arrange a 4 day safari taking in Lake Manyara, Serengeti and Ngorongoro Crater. Due to late booking on our part the Lodges were not available so we opted for a basic camping trip (which I would thoroughly recommend, as long as you do not mind basic wash facilities). Despite not having any camping experience, or equipment, we really enjoyed the camping experience. Bobby tours had organised all the equipment for us within the price, so we had no worries about carrying our own equipment. The tour company provided us with a car, driver (Umari) and a cook (Macho). Umari was knowledgeable about the local areas, national parks and wildlife, and was very accomodating whenever we needed anything. Macho was great with providing us with Breakfast, Lunch, afternoon tea and Dinner (we even requested him to make us the local staple food of \'Ugali\' which he duely made). All in all this was a great family safari experience, and one which we would recommend to any family that is looking to have fun and enjoy three of the most beautiful places on earth.
